Title: Gunter Wichmann: Innovator in Sensor Technology

Introduction

Gunter Wichmann is a notable inventor based in Leimen, Germany. He has made significant contributions to the field of sensor technology, particularly in applications related to projectile fuzes and automotive safety.

Latest Patents

Wichmann holds four patents, showcasing his innovative approach to solving complex problems. One of his latest inventions is a distance sensor for projectile fuzes. This device utilizes a range finder that operates on the principle of pulse propagation time. The system radiates a signal through an antenna, capturing reflections from targets to distinguish between metal and non-metal objects. Another significant patent is a method and apparatus for determining the range of vision of a motor vehicle driver in foggy conditions. This invention employs a transmitter and receiver mounted on the vehicle to monitor roadway reflections, providing warnings to the driver when hazardous conditions arise.
